Understanding Common Window Issues
Before diving into repairs, it helps to determine the source of the issue. Not all window concerns require expert intervention, however understanding what you are dealing with is the primary step towards the very best window repair strategy.
1. Drafts and Air Leaks
Over time, the caulking and weatherstripping around windows deteriorate. This causes unpleasant drafts, temperature level changes inside the rooms, and an obvious spike in cooling and heating bills.
2. Foggy or Condensation-Filled Glass
If a double-pane or triple-pane window develops a milky, foggy appearance between the glass panes, it indicates the seal has failed. This jeopardizes the window's insulating gas (like argon) and lowers its thermal performance.
3. Stuck or Hard-to-Open Windows
House settling, humidity, paint accumulation, or rusted hardware can trigger windows to stick, jam, or refuse to stay open.
4. Broken or Broken Glass
A roaming baseball, an extreme storm, or an unintentional impact can split a pane. While cosmetic, it likewise presents a severe security threat and an immediate thermal leakage.
Repair vs. Replacement: Making the Right Choice
Among the most common issues house owners deal with is whether to fix an existing window or purchase a new setup. While replacement uses a blank slate, it is frequently much more costly and disruptive.
Function Window Repair Window Replacement
Average Cost Low to Moderate (₤ 100-- ₤ 400 per window) High (₤ 500-- ₤ 1,500+ per window)
Time Required A few hours or less Days (depending upon the number of windows)
Disruption Very little; mainly consisted of to the window area Moderate to High; exterior and interior trim may be disturbed
Best For Broken glass, damaged seals, drafty weatherstripping, malfunctioning hardware Rotted wood frames, structural damage, obsoleted single-pane glass
As a general general rule, if the structural frame and sash of the window are sound, repair work is often the more cost-effective and sustainable choice.
Types of Professional Window Repairs
When property owners try to find the best window repair services, they are usually seeking solutions to specific structural or functional failures. Here are the most common types of repairs carried out by specialists:
Glass Unit (IGU) Replacement: Instead of changing the entire frame, professionals can pop out the stopped working double-pane glass unit and set up a new, sealed glass insert.
Weatherstripping and Caulking Renewal: Stripping away old, fragile sealing products and replacing them with modern-day, high-efficiency weatherstripping instantly stops drafts.
Hardware and Mechanism Fixes: Repairing or changing broken cranks, latches, balances, and depends upon sash, awning, and double-hung windows.
Sash Cord and Chain Replacement: For older, historical double-hung windows, changing frayed ropes or chains ensures the window stays open correctly.

Do It Yourself Window Maintenance and Minor Fixes
While intricate concerns like glass replacement or structural sash repair need expert proficiency, homeowners can manage a number of small maintenance jobs by themselves.
Lubing Moving Parts: Apply a silicone-based spray or dry lube to tracks, hinges, and locks each year to keep them running smoothly. Avoid heavy grease, which draws in dirt and dust.
Applying Fresh Caulk: Scrape away old, split outside caulk and use a fresh bead of exterior-grade silicone caulk to seal spaces around the window frame.
Changing Weatherstripping: Peel off old foam or vinyl weatherstripping, clean the surface area, and push brand-new adhesive-backed weatherstripping into place around the sash boundary.
Washing Tracks and Weep Holes: Debris accumulation in moving window tracks and exterior weep holes can trigger water to back up into the home. Clear these out frequently utilizing a soft brush and a little quantity of soapy water.
